For New Vegas, the save file is only part of a reproducible modded setup. Back up the entire Saves folder and separately record the active mod list before changing load order or moving progress to another PC.
Where Fallout: New Vegas stores PC saves
The researched save-location boundary is Windows: %USERPROFILE%DocumentsMy GamesFalloutNVSaves. The known file or folder pattern is *.fos save files plus paired metadata/backup artifacts when present. This is the practical starting point because launcher, profile, and storefront context can change which copy is active even when two folders look similar.

What the files represent
New Vegas uses Bethesda Gamebryo save records with the .fos extension. Mods, DLC, load order, and script state can be embedded in progress, so a byte-level file match does not guarantee a safe modded restore. If the save is not where expected
If progress is missing after a restore, confirm the active Windows account, storefront/profile, cloud state, and exact directory first. Restore the untouched backup before experimenting with individual files or older autosaves. Also check redirected Documents folders, Steam Play prefixes, account IDs, and launcher-specific containers where applicable. Preserve every candidate copy before testing a restore so troubleshooting does not destroy the only surviving version.
